Lemon Balm, scientifically known as Melissa officinalis, is a perennial herb from the Lamiaceae family. Native to Europe and Asia, Lemon Balm is now cultivated worldwide for its refreshing lemony aroma, culinary uses, and medicinal benefits.
1. Calming and Relaxing: Lemon Balm is known for its calming and relaxing effects on the nervous system. It may help reduce stress, anxiety, and promote relaxation.
2. Sleep Aid: Lemon Balm is used to support sleep quality and improve insomnia by promoting relaxation and easing restlessness.
3. Digestive Health: Lemon Balm is used to support digestive health and may help alleviate indigestion, bloating, and gas.
4. Cognitive Support: Lemon Balm is believed to have cognitive benefits and may support mental focus and clarity.
5. Mood Enhancement: Lemon Balm is used to improve mood and lift spirits, making it beneficial for individuals experiencing mild mood disturbances.
6. Anti-viral Properties: Lemon Balm has natural anti-viral properties that may help combat certain viruses, including herpes simplex virus (HSV).
7. Immune System Support: Lemon Balm is rich in antioxidants and vitamins that support the immune system and overall health.
8. Skin Health: Lemon Balm is used in skincare for its potential to soothe and promote healthy skin.
9. Respiratory Support: Lemon Balm is used to support respiratory health and may help relieve symptoms of colds and congestion.
10. Muscle Relaxation: Lemon Balm may help relax muscles and ease muscle tension.
11. Menstrual Health: Lemon Balm is believed to have benefits for women's health, including supporting menstrual health and relieving menstrual cramps.
12. Oral Health: Lemon Balm is used in oral care products for its potential to promote oral health and freshen breath.
13. Antioxidant Rich: Lemon Balm contains antioxidants that help neutralize free radicals and protect cells from oxidative damage.
14. Gastrointestinal Relief: Lemon Balm may provide relief from gastrointestinal discomfort and soothe stomach cramps.
15. Culinary Delight: In addition to its medicinal properties, Lemon Balm is used as a flavorful herb in various culinary dishes, salads, and teas.
